Maison > développement back-end > Tutoriel C#.Net > Quelles classes existe-t-il en C# ?

Quelles classes existe-t-il en C# ?

PHPz
Libérer: 2023-08-26 15:37:02
avant
1408 Les gens l'ont consulté

Quelles classes existe-t-il en C# ?

Lorsque vous définissez une classe, vous définissez un modèle pour votre type de données. Les objets sont des instances de classes. Les méthodes et variables qui composent une classe sont appelées membres de la classe.

Une définition de classe commence par le mot-clé class, suivi du nom de la classe et du corps de la classe entouré d'une paire d'accolades. Voici la forme générale d'une définition de classe -

<access specifier> class class_name {

   // member variables
   <access specifier> <data type> variable1;
   <access specifier> <data type> variable2;
   ...
   <access specifier> <data type> variableN;
   // member methods
   <access specifier> <return type> method1(parameter_list) {
      // method body
   }  

   <access specifier> <return type> method2(parameter_list) {
      // method body
   }
   ...
   <access specifier> <return type> methodN(parameter_list) {
      // method body
   }
}
Copier après la connexion

Voici quelques points importants sur une classe -

  • Les spécificateurs d'accès précisent les membres ainsi que les règles d'accès à la classe elle-même. S’il n’est pas mentionné, le spécificateur d’accès par défaut pour un type de classe est interne. L'accès par défaut pour les membres est privé.

  • Le type de données spécifie le type de la variable et le type de retour spécifie le type de données des données renvoyées par la méthode (le cas échéant).

  • Pour accéder aux membres de la classe, vous pouvez utiliser l'opérateur point (.).

  • L'opérateur point convertit le nom de l'objet en nom du membre.

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!

source:tutorialspoint.com
Déclaration de ce site Web
Le contenu de cet article est volontairement contribué par les internautes et les droits d'auteur appartiennent à l'auteur original. Ce site n'assume aucune responsabilité légale correspondante. Si vous trouvez un contenu suspecté de plagiat ou de contrefaçon, veuillez contacter admin@php.cn
Tutoriels populaires
Plus>
Derniers téléchargements
Plus>
effets Web
Code source du site Web
Matériel du site Web
Modèle frontal